mcvnc

VNC client as an MCP server. Gives language models interactive access to remote desktops -- connect to VNC sessions, capture screenshots, send keyboard and mouse input, read and write the clipboard.

Built on FastMCP and asyncvnc2.

Install

pip install mcvnc

Or with uv:

uv tool install mcvnc

Quickstart

Claude Code

claude mcp add mcvnc -- uvx mcvnc

Other MCP hosts (stdio transport)

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"mcvnc": {
      "command": "uvx",
      "args": ["mcvnc"]
    }
  }
}

Manual / development

git clone https://git.supported.systems/warehack.ing/mcvnc.git
cd mcvnc
make install  # uv sync --group dev
make run      # uv run mcvnc

Tools

Connection

Tool Description
vnc_connect Connect to a VNC server (host, port, password)
vnc_disconnect Close a session
vnc_list_sessions List active connections
vnc_session_info Details for a specific session

Screen

Tool Description
vnc_screenshot Full-desktop screenshot (returns inline PNG + metadata)
vnc_screenshot_region Capture a specific rectangle of the desktop
vnc_screen_info Desktop dimensions without capturing
vnc_wait_for_screen_change Wait until the screen updates after an interaction

Input

Tool Description
vnc_type_text Type a string of text
vnc_press_key Press a single key (Enter, Tab, Escape, etc.)
vnc_key_combo Key combination (Ctrl+C, Alt+F4, etc.)
vnc_click Click at coordinates (left/right/middle)
vnc_double_click Double-click at coordinates
vnc_move Move the mouse cursor
vnc_drag Click-drag from one point to another
vnc_scroll Scroll up or down

Clipboard

Tool Description
vnc_get_clipboard Read the remote clipboard
vnc_set_clipboard Write to the remote clipboard

Typical workflow

vnc_connect  ->  vnc_screenshot  ->  interpret UI  ->  interact
                      ^                                    |
                      |                                    v
                      +----  vnc_screenshot  <----  vnc_wait_for_screen_change

Use vnc_screenshot_region when you only care about a dialog, menu, or status bar -- it requests just that rectangle from the VNC server instead of the full desktop.

Use vnc_wait_for_screen_change after interactions to wait for the UI to actually update before taking the next screenshot. Optionally pass a region to watch for changes only within that area.

Configuration

All settings via environment variables, all optional:

Variable Default Description
MCVNC_DEFAULT_PORT 5900 Default VNC port
MCVNC_CONNECTION_TIMEOUT 10 Connection timeout (seconds)
MCVNC_SCREENSHOT_TIMEOUT 30 Screenshot timeout (seconds)
MCVNC_SCREENSHOT_MAX_WIDTH 0 Max screenshot width, 0 = no limit
MCVNC_WAIT_CHANGE_TIMEOUT 5 Wait-for-change timeout (seconds)

Development

make install   # uv sync --group dev
make test      # pytest
make lint      # ruff check

License

GPL-3.0-or-later -- required by the asyncvnc2 dependency.
